He Let Me Drink His Poison, So I Sold His Empire to His Rival

For three years, Francesca Bellandi risked her life drinking poisoned cups to protect her mafia partner, Lorenzo Corsetti. But during their empire's grand celebration, she uncovers a devastating truth. Lorenzo is mocking her loyalty, sharing her vital medicine with another woman, and drinking freely. Realizing his deadly allergy was a cruel lie designed to exploit her devotion, Francesca decides she is done. She silently liquidates her entire stake in his syndicate, leaving him to ruin.

Chapter 4

I looked down at the wine bleeding across my chest, dark as old blood on silk, and laughed out loud.

"Three years at the sit-downs, taking every cup that should have finished you, and all you ever did was carry the garbage out for me. Take the trash. He's yours."

"You're calling the Don garbage? You think you've earned the right?"

Adriana smiled and lifted her hand.

I threw my arm up to block the blow, but she only smiled wider and slapped herself. Twice. Hard.

She showed her own face no mercy. Her cheek swelled red in an instant.

"Ah! Francesca! Why did you hit me?"

She shrieked it loud enough to carry down the corridor, ripped open her own collar, and screamed for someone to help her.

When Lorenzo came through the door, he caught her at the precise moment she looked her most broken.

He didn't care that it was the women's washroom. He crossed the tile in three strides and pulled Adriana into his arms.

He stripped off his jacket and settled it over her shoulders, gentling her like something wounded.

"I'm here. Don't be afraid."

Then he turned to me, and the warmth went out of him like a door closing.

"Francesca! You're drunk!"

"Apologize to Adriana!"

He didn't ask a single question. In a world built on who you trust, he had already chosen. He believed her without condition.

I shook my head and refused.

"I didn't touch her. She threw the wine on me, then staged all of this—"

Adriana wept harder, right on cue.

"Don Corsetti, don't blame Francesca. It's my fault. I saw her reaching for another glass right after she'd been sick, so I told her to go easy. I knocked the wine from her hand so she couldn't drink. I deserved to be hit."

At that, Lorenzo struck me across the face.

The sound of it cracked flat in the tiled room. Somewhere out in the corridor a glass was set down too carefully, and the murmuring stopped.

"Francesca. Are you sober now?"

He pointed at Adriana's swelling cheek, his voice gone cold and level.

"Look at what you've done. If you can't hold your liquor, then you don't sit at the table. And now here you are, drunk, out of control, shaming yourself in front of the whole Family."

"Do you have any idea what you become with a few cups in you? The last sit-down, you mistook one of the associates for me and put on a show in the back of the car. I let it go. I didn't want you disgraced in front of them. And now you've raised your hand to Adriana and you still won't own it."

"Did you take one of the associates to bed and get caught, and now you'll hide behind the wine for that too? Do you think every man in this life is me? That they'll swallow whatever you hand them, no matter what it costs?"

Had I truly been drunk, I would probably have parroted every word back to him and gone down on my knees to Adriana.

But I had never been more clear-headed in my life.

Clear-headed enough to see exactly what I was worth in his eyes.

Three years of taking the poisoned cups meant for him, my ruined stomach, all of it, reduced to nonsense.

It was too absurd.

The noise had carried far enough to draw a crowd to the doorway. Made men, their wives, associates, the whole glittering feast of the Corsetti operation come to watch.

Word passed from mouth to mouth, and within a breath every one of them believed the deals I'd closed for this Family had been closed on my back.

They pointed. They whispered behind ringed fingers.

"Dio, a woman like that thinks she'll stand beside the Don? How could she ever deserve him?"

Someone else added, thick with sarcasm.

"She's had plenty of men. Clearly she's got her own particular talents."

"What talents? I wouldn't mind a taste myself. Is that all it takes to close a deal with her?"

Some drunk near the bar whistled at me through his teeth.

The anger on Lorenzo's face vanished the instant that whistle landed. Not a flicker of it left.

"Francesca! Apologize to Adriana! Or the surprise I had planned for tonight is finished!"

He was using the ring, the thing he'd promised me, as a blade to my throat.

I didn't care anymore.

"Lorenzo. We're done."

His face froze, disbelief carved into it.

"You strike someone, and now you throw a fit and demand we're finished?"

"You're drunk out of your mind. Since you love your wine and your scenes so much, tonight I'll let you have your fill. Let everyone here see exactly what you turn into."

He dragged me into the private room and forced the liquor down my throat in front of a table full of young women in borrowed silk.

However I struggled, his hand wouldn't ease.

One of the girls couldn't stomach it and spoke up.

"Don Corsetti, if something happens to Francesca from being made to drink like this, it falls on you. You'll answer for it."

But Lorenzo turned on her with a look that shut her mouth.

"Don't concern yourself. She's mine. Whatever happens to her, I'll answer for it."
